Austep The use of membrane filtration results in the separation of two streams, a concentrate and a permeate.
Usually the goal of membrane filtration is to obtain a better quality of the permeate or concentrate as much as possible, reducing the volume to maximum, the current that keeps the pollutant or the product recovery.
The fields of application are different in the case of treatment normally apply to downstream of a primary treatment and/or biological, and aim to provide high quality to the effluent.

AUSTEP always uses membrane technology for wastewater treatment, with applications ranging from the concentration of oil emulsions, the tertiary filtration.
The sizing and selection of membranes depends on the nature of water and effluent quality requirements. Some important things to consider are the variability of flow, the presence of pollutants that cause fouling chemical or biological (eg. high concentrations of calcium or fat), the presence of aggressive molecules that can damage the membrane.
Every aspect is carefully assessed in the development of the project and in preparing the treatment program.
